Finally the time has come to take off the winter wheels and put on the nicer:

Wheel brand/name:Skoda Blossom, made by Borbet

Size: 7x17

ET: 45

Tyre: Dunlop Sportmaxx RT 225/45R17

Any other mods, e.g. springs, coilovers etc: Stock
